Let A=√((-6)2+52)=√61
Draw a right triangle, horizontal leg from the origin to x=-6, vertical leg from (-6,0) to (-6,5). The angle Θ, in the second quadrant, from the positive x-axis to the hypotenuse, is our guy.
cosΘ=-6/A, sinΘ=5/A. Our expression now reads
A(cosΘsin8t+sinΘcos8t)=Asin(8t+Θ)
